- The distance between Puerto Aysen, Chile and Santiago, Chile is approximately 1,334 km or 829 mi.
- To reach Puerto Aysen in this distance one would set out from Santiago bearing 186.8° or S and follow the great circles arc to approach Puerto Aysen bearing 188° or S .
- Puerto Aysen has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Santiago has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k).
- Puerto Aysen is in or near the cool temperate rain forest biome whereas Santiago is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ome.
- The average temperature is 4.6 °C (8.3°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.2 °C (5.8°F) less in Puerto Aysen.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 2385.5 mm (93.9 in) more which is equivalent to 2385.5 l/m² (58.55 US gal/ft²) or 23,855,000 l/ha (2,550,258 US gal/ac) more. About 10 1/8 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 11.9° lower in Puerto Aysen than in Santiago.
- Relative humidity levels are 14.9% higher.
- The mean dew point temperature is 1.5°C (2.7°F) lower.
